Defining Coffee Flavor Syrups
These flavor enhancers are concentrated sugar solutions infused with natural or artificial taste essences. They mix easily into any beverage for even distribution.
The basic recipe involves dissolving sugar in hot water until fully incorporated. Then you add flavor extracts like vanilla, peppermint, or seasonal spices.
This simple process creates versatile sweeteners for your daily drink routine.
Syrup Versus Sauce: Key Differences
Understanding the distinction between these two products helps you choose the right option.
Syrups are thin liquids designed for sweetening and flavoring. They blend smoothly throughout your beverage.
Sauces provide thicker, creamier textures perfect for decorative drizzles. They work well in rich drinks like mochas where you want visual appeal and decadent mouthfeel.
| Feature | Syrup | Sauce |
|---|---|---|
| Consistency | Thin, pourable liquid | Thick, viscous texture |
| Primary Use | Even flavor distribution | Decorative drizzles |
| Mixing Ability | Blends completely | Layers and separates |
| Best For | Daily coffee enhancement | Special occasion drinks |
Homemade versions of both options can be created quickly. The concentrated nature of these flavor carriers means each taste shines through clearly.
Choose syrup for everyday sweetness and sauce for special texture effects.

Quick and Easy Syrup Recipes
Let’s dive into recipes that bring café-quality taste to your home kitchen. These simple formulas require minimal effort but deliver maximum flavor impact.
Under 15 Minute Recipes for Every Palate
Start with the basic foundation to make simple syrup: combine equal parts sugar and hot water.
Stir until the sugar dissolves completely, which takes about 3-5 minutes.
Then add your chosen natural extract.
For a classic vanilla option, use pure Madagascar vanilla extract. This creates smooth, rich sweetness that pairs beautifully with any beverage.
It serves as an excellent base for flavor experimentation.
Create caramel flavor by adding brown sugar to your base recipe. This delivers buttery, molasses-like notes without lengthy cooking.
Hazelnut extract provides caramelized nutty tones that remain timelessly popular.
Seasonal enthusiasts will love pumpkin spice variation. Combine your sugar base with c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, and vanilla.
This works year-round for those who enjoy warm spice profiles.
Related: Making Salted Caramel syrup – Excellent for fall and winter drinks.
Adjust sweetness and intensity to match your preferences. Add more extract for stronger taste or reduce sugar for lighter sweetness.
These concentrated formulas ensure each flavor shines through clearly.
Store your creations in clean, airtight bottles in the refrigerator. They remain fresh for 2-4 weeks, giving you plenty of time to enjoy your homemade additions.

Finding the Right Ratio and Balance
Start with these standard measurements for optimal sweetness. Adjust based on your personal taste preferences.
| Cup Size | Pumps | Ounces |
|---|---|---|
| 8 oz | 1 pump | ½ oz |
| 12 oz | 2 pumps | 1 oz |
| 16 oz | 3 pumps | 1 ½ oz |
| 20 oz | 4 pumps | 2 oz |
| 24 oz | 5 pumps | 2 ½ oz |
These amounts provide a starting point for your flavor exploration. Some people prefer less sweetness while others enjoy more pronounced taste.
Balance the sweetness with your drink’s natural bitter notes. The goal is enhancement rather than overwhelming the inherent characteristics.
For steamed milk drinks, add your syrup to the milk pitcher before heating. This ensures complete flavor incorporation throughout your beverage.
Experimenting with Flavor Combinations
Try classic pairings like vanilla-hazelnut or caramel-cinnamon. These create complex taste profiles that elevate your experience.
Start with complementary flavors before exploring contrasting combinations. Vanilla with almond offers harmonious nutty notes.
Keep notes on your experiments to replicate successful creations. Adjust syrup ratios based on your coffee’s roast level.
Darker roasts with more bitter notes may benefit from a bit more syrup. Lighter roasts need less to maintain their subtle flavor characteristics.
